Jayadeva Hospital is an upcoming important double-elevated interchange metro station on the North-South corridor of the Yellow Line and Pink Line of Namma Metro in Bangalore, India. This metro station will be Bengaluru's first ever multi-elevated interchange metro station in the whole of Namma Metro network. Around this metro station holds the main Sri Jayadeva Institute of Cardiovascular Sciences and Research Healthcare Institute followed by Valtech, a software company in Bengaluru.

As per latest reports, the Yellow Line is stated to be operational post May 2024 due to the upcoming Indian general election which will occur during April-May 2024 [1][2][3][4] (under Pink Line, around 2025).

Station layout

This metro station will comprise of 5 levels from underground to the top level as given below:-

  • Level 1 → Underpass connecting Bannerghatta and Dairy Circle
  • Level 2 → Street Level surface connecting Ragigudda and BTM Layout
  • Level 3 → Elevated Flyover from Ragigudda to Central Silk Board
  • Level 4 → Yellow Line Platforms
  • Level 5 → Pink Line Platforms
